Recommend checking out United Policyholders (“UP”), which is a non-profit that offers a ton of info on disaster-related insurance claims, legal issues, and rebuilding/repairs.

Why I think UP is a reliable resource: UP has been around since 1991; does NOT accept funding from insurance companies; and sources info from both experts and previous disaster survivors.

UP has a landing page specifically for victims of the recent LA fires, which you can check out here: https://uphelp.org/disaster-recovery-help/2025cawildfires/

I definitely understand that the 7-month hiatus gave the queens an opportunity to re-evaluate their looks, but I think it’s unfair to punish them for not totally overhauling everything. As some of the queens mentioned, gigs dried up during the pandemic - meaning that the queens likely had less money than ever to spend on wardrobe upgrades. And, RPDRUK doesn’t give out cash prizes so the queens can’t even hold on to the hope of recouping financial losses by winning a huge jackpot if they’re crowned (or even a fat tip if they win a challenge). I’m sure the rebuttal to this is that it isn’t about money, it’s about “resourcefulness”/“creativity.” But that also seems unfair, because I suspect that lots of craft/garment supply stores were also shut down or limited in stock during covid. I’m not sure that any of this defends some of the most basic looks that ended up on the runway, but I wish some of these challenges were acknowledged during the episode.
